What a Workers Compensation Lawyer Involves
A workers compensation lawyer does far more than simply submitting forms. Qualified representation in this area includes investigating the details of the accident, building a file of evidence, challenging claim denials, and representing you at hearings when disputes arise.
Workers compensation representation is built around employees across a broad range of occupations — office staff, warehouse employees, and every working person in California. You do not need to prove that your employer was negligent in order to qualify for benefits. Benefits are available regardless of fault, which means your focus can stay on healing and returning to work.

Frequently Asked Questions About Workers Compensation Lawyer Help
These are some of the questions we hear most often about hiring a workers compensation lawyer:
What does a workers compensation lawyer charge?Lawyers handling these cases charge only if you win, meaning there is no out-of-pocket cost to start. The contingency percentage are regulated by the state and usually amount to a regulated percentage of your final benefit. You take on no monetary risk to consult with us.
What is the typical timeline for a workers comp claim?Every case moves at a different pace based on how disputed your claim is. Simple files with minimal dispute sometimes close in under a year. Files where the insurer disputes everything sometimes run two or more years. A workers compensation lawyer can outline what to expect in your specific situation.
What types of injuries qualify for workers compensation benefits?California workers compensation covers most injuries arising from your employment. Qualifying injuries range from sprains, fractures, and back injuries as well as conditions that develop gradually over time and occupational diseases. Stress and psychiatric conditions may qualify if they are caused or aggravated by your job responsibilities.
Can my employer fire me for filing a workers compensation claim?Terminating or punishing an employee for making a claim is illegal under California law. What are the first steps after getting hurt at work?Tell your employer immediately — the law sets strict deadlines for reporting to preserve your right to benefits. Seek medical attention right away and be certain your visit is documented as work-related.
